Endometriosis Awareness Month
Published: 13/03/25

Endometriosis Awareness Month is taking place throughout March and is dedicated to raising awareness about endometriosis, a chronic and painful condition affecting many women across the UK. This month provides an opportunity to increase public understanding of the condition and encourage those who are suffering to seek medical advice from their GP practice.
Endometriosis is an often-debilitating condition which affects around 1 in 10 women throughout the UK, women and girls are not only impacted by chronic pain and exhaustion, it can also impact their fertility, mental wellbeing and day-to-day life.
The aim of this activity is to raise awareness of the condition and common symptoms among the wider society so they are able to better understand Endometriosis and support women and girls they may know who suffer from this disease or get help for troublesome symptoms that they have been experiencing for some time.
